The problem with most bids
Plumbing customers often call 2–3 plumbers. The one who sends a clear written proposal first — not just a verbal quote — usually wins.

Common mistakes that cost you the job
- Giving verbal quotes only — nothing in writing
- Not specifying parts brands or materials
- Not including access/cleanup language
- No mention of warranty on parts and labor
Pricing guidance
Plumbing proposals should include a diagnostic fee (if applicable), parts cost, labor, and permit fees if needed. Itemizing shows transparency and builds trust.
Frequently asked questions
Do plumbers need written proposals?
For any job over a few hundred dollars, yes. It protects both you and the customer and reduces disputes.
What should a plumbing proposal include?
Scope of work, parts list, labor estimate, timeline, warranty on parts and labor, and your license number.
